Salt Cedar Control Funded


                The Texas State Soil & Water Conservation Board approved funds for 2007 salt cedar control for the Pecos and Upper Colorado River watersheds.  This money will be used in conjunction with the USDA/EQUIP program and provides a maximum 25% cost-share to landowners with a maximum cost of $235 per acre.

                To be considered for funding, applications are due in the Brush Control Project office by Jan. 5, 2007.  Applications need to be filled out, signed and dated by both the landowner and district board before submission the brush office, and will be funded on a first-come, first-serve basis.  Applications not funded will be returned to the district and may be resubmitted for the next funding cycle.  Contact the brush office at 325-481-0335 for more information.
